Overview
The AD7175-2BRUZ-RL7 is a high-performance, 24-bit, sigma-delta analog-to-digital converter (ADC) manufactured by Analog Devices Inc. This device is designed for low-bandwidth input applications and offers a range of features that make it versatile and efficient. It integrates key analog and digital signal conditioning blocks, allowing users to configure individual settings for each analog input channel. The AD7175-2 is particularly suited for applications requiring fast settling times, high accuracy, and low noise performance.
Key Specifications
Parameter | Specification |
---|---|
Resolution | 24 bits |
Output Data Rate | 5 SPS to 250 kSPS |
Channel Scan Rate | 50 kSPS/channel (20 µs settling) |
Noise Free Bits | 17.2 bits at 250 kSPS, 20 bits at 2.5 kSPS, 24 bits at 20 SPS |
Integral Non-Linearity (INL) | ±1 ppm of FSR |
Power Supply | AVDD1 = 5 V, AVDD2 = IOVDD = 2 V to 5 V, or ±2.5 V AVDD1/AVSS |
Temperature Range | −40°C to +105°C |
Package | 24-Lead TSSOP |
Internal Reference | 2.5 V, ±2 ppm/°C drift |
Input Channels | 2 fully differential or 4 single-ended channels |
Key Features
- Fast and flexible output rate: 5 SPS to 250 kSPS
- True rail-to-rail analog and reference input buffers
- User configurable input channels: 2 fully differential or 4 single-ended channels
- Crosspoint multiplexer for channel selection
- On-chip 2.5 V reference with ±2 ppm/°C drift
- Internal or external clock option
- Simultaneous 50 Hz/60 Hz rejection with digital filter
- Offset and gain calibration registers on a per channel basis
- Serial digital interface (SPI, QSPI, MICROWIRE, and DSP compatible)
Applications
- Process control: PLC/DCS modules
- Temperature and pressure measurement
- Medical and scientific multichannel instrumentation
- Chromatography
